For more information about linux User management commands-general Linux technology-Linux technology and application, see the following. Id username: displays the user id, group id, and user group id.
Who displays users logging on to the system
WWho's enhanced command displays the users logging on to the system, what they are doing, and how their processors are used. It is a common security command.
Finger username: displays the user's system information
Last display of users who recently logged on to the system, often used as a means of system security detection
Lastb shows recent unsuccessful login attempts
Free display of system memory information
More/proc/filesystems displays information about the file system currently in use
Setup uses the root user to configure the mouse, sound card, keyboard, system service, etc.
